Expenses paid in cash allowed in capital gain?

Others 176 views 2 replies
Respected Experts,

One of our client sold her house for ₹ 1 crore in 2018. Purchased in 2012 for ₹ 50 lakhs. She spent ₹ 29 lakhs for improvement which was paid in cash. Cash amount withdrawn from mortgage loan taken for improvement.

are these expenses paid in cash admissible for calculating capital gain?
Replies (2)
if there are proper documents available to satisfy the officer regarding it's genuineness then it will be allowed else not
allowed but u should ignore the same because cash transactions attracts penalty in other sections of the income tax act
